CBA: Shenzhen wins 7th straight game, Shanghai edges Beijing
By Xinhua

BEIJING - The Shenzhen Aviators sailed past the Sichuan Blue Whales 117-98 for their seventh consecutive win in the Chinese Basketball Association (CBA) here on Sunday.

He Xining scored 26 points to lead six players in double figures for Shenzhen, and Jared Sullinger finished with 12 points, 13 rebounds and eight assists.

Shenzhen built a 51-41 lead at the break. He Xining took over the game to help Shenzhen extend the lead to 30 points in the third quarter.

The Shanghai Sharks edged the Beijing Ducks 102-98 as Wang Zhelin had 15 points and 12 rebounds.

Shanghai led 25-20 in the first quarter. Lei Meng hit consecutive 3-pointers to put Beijing up briefly, 30-29, but Shanghai regained the lead before the break.

Shanghai took its largest lead of the game at 72-60 in the third quarter. Beijing cut the deficit to 96-94 with two minutes and 45 seconds left in the fourth before Wang Zhelin sealed the victory for Shanghai.

In other games on Sunday, the Jilin Northeast Tigers beat the Ningbo Rockets 96-95, and the Shandong Heroes smashed the Fujian Sturgeons 109-87.
